
Menghabiskan hadiah penambangan
Teks ini untuk membantu penambang menarik dana yang ditambang.
Banyak orang meluncurkan node dan juga penambang, dengan pubkeyHex dari penambang yang disematkan dalam konfigurasi node. Sekarang
informasi tentang cara mengenali koin yang ditambang dan menariknya ke alamat lain.
Tentang kunci.
Seorang penambang dapat melihat banyak kunci dalam berbagai format.
Pertama, perangkat lunak penambangan dan juga dukungan penambangan di node (yaitu, pengaturan ergo.node.miningPubKeyHex dalam konfigurasi) menggunakan kunci publik "raw" yang di-Base16-encoded, yang hanya merupakan titik terenkode yang diserialisasi pada kurva elips. Kunci ini cukup untuk seorang penambang (yang dapat menghindari dukungan Base58, pembentukan alamat, dll).
Kedua, dompet node menunjukkan alamat Pay-To-Public-Key (P2PK), yang dimulai dengan "9". Alamat P2PK tidak hanya berisi titik kurva elips, tetapi juga prefiks jaringan dan checksum, mirip dengan alamat Bitcoin P2PK dan P2PKH.
Ketiga, ada metode API minig/rewardAddress, yang ditujukan untuk alat eksternal yang menghasilkan kandidat blok. Metode API ini menunjukkan sesuatu seperti 88dhgzEuTXaSfKEbxfa6vghvEGdBH39sn9h7As2Y2Z6SGd8bKXCXmRLY5JtU4g4RYBP4WcZWb3JwjXDK, yang merupakan skrip khusus untuk membayar penambang dalam bentuk terenkode.
Bagaimanapun, jika Anda memasukkan pubkeyHex dari penambang Anda ke dalam node Anda, semuanya baik-baik saja, jangan khawatir tentang kunci yang berbeda yang terlihat.
Mendapatkan saldo Anda ditampilkan & penarikan
Mungkin Anda tidak melihat koin yang ditambang setelah inisialisasi dompet, jika dilakukan pada ketinggian setelah blok ditambang. Harap dicatat,
nodes tidak memindai blok ke belakang, hanya memindai blok baru setelah inisialisasi. Oleh karena itu, untuk menemukan koin yang ditambang, pemindaian ulang blockchain penuh diperlukan saat ini (atau, jika Anda menambang, luncurkan node lain di mesin lain, atau di mesin yang sama dengan port berbeda yang diatur dalam konfigurasi, yaitu, atur nilai baru untuk bidang scorex.restApi.bindAddress dan scorex.network.bindAddress; juga harap gunakan versi 3.0.1 karena lebih mudah untuk dikonfigurasi).
Untuk menghabiskan hadiah Anda perlu mengikuti langkah-langkah di bawah ini:
1. Bersihkan status node, jika Anda akan menghentikan node yang bekerja.
Untuk membersihkan status node Anda, Anda perlu menghentikan node dan kemudian menghapus semua konten direktori .ergo (itu mungkin tersembunyi dari Anda di Mac dan Linux, coba perintah ls -a di direktori tempat Anda menjalankan node).
2. Memulihkan dompet lokal dari frasa benih yang digunakan di penambang Autolykos
Ingat kalimat mnemonik yang Anda atur di config.json saat mengonfigurasi penambang Autolykos Anda - sekarang Anda perlu memulihkan dompet bawaan darinya. Untuk memulihkan dompet Anda, mulai node lagi dan kirim permintaan POST ke http://[your_node_ip]:9053/wallet/restore yang berisi tubuh tipe konten application/json seperti:
{
"pass": "your_wallet_pass",
"mnemonic": "mnemonic_sentense_from_your_miner",
"mnemonicPass": "mnemonic_pass_if_set"
}
, di mana pass adalah kata sandi unik baru yang akan digunakan untuk mengenkripsi data dompet di disk lokal Anda, dan mnemonic adalah frasa mnemonik yang Anda salin dari konfigurasi penambang Autolykos Anda (config.json). Harap perhatikan khusus pada bidang mnemonicPass - ini adalah kata sandi dari frasa mnemonik Anda, ini opsional dan Anda bisa mengonfigurasinya saat menghasilkan mnemonik Anda. Jadi tambahkan bidang ini ke permintaan hanya jika mnemonik Anda benar-benar dilindungi dengan kata sandi, hapus bidang ini jika tidak.
Jangan lupa untuk mengotorisasi permintaan Anda dengan mengatur header HTTP api_key yang sesuai dengan apiKeyHash yang Anda konfigurasikan di file konfigurasi node.
PERHATIAN: Untuk membiarkan dompet memindai semua blok dari genesis, Anda perlu memulihkan dompet sebelum node Anda mulai mengunduh blok penuh (Periksa fullHeight dalam respons metode API /info - selama itu null node Anda belum mulai mengunduh blok penuh)
3. Periksa saldo Anda
Ketika node Anda disinkronkan dengan jaringan, periksa metode API /wallet/balances. Responsnya harus terlihat seperti:
{
"height": 3560,
"balance": 67500000000,
"assets": {}
}
Perhatikan terlebih dahulu pada bidang height - itu harus sama dengan fullHeight yang ditampilkan oleh rute API /info. balance adalah saldo yang dikonfirmasi yang ditemukan oleh dompet Anda.
4. Lakukan transaksi menghabiskan hadiah Anda
Untuk menarik hadiah dari dompet Anda, buat transaksi pembayaran baru menggunakan rute API /wallet/payment/send. Untuk melakukan operasi ini, kirim permintaan POST yang berisi tubuh tipe konten application/json seperti:
{
"address": "your_address",
"value": 10000000
}
, di mana address adalah alamat yang ingin Anda pindahkan dana Anda dan value adalah berapa banyak nanoERGs yang ingin Anda pindahkan.
Ketika permintaan dikirim, node akan mengembalikan id transaksi dalam respons. Anda dapat menggunakan explorer untuk memeriksa kapan transaksi Anda masuk ke blok.
Share post
13 Agustus 2025
9 Juli 2025






